Output 52b8ec58cf4d49395f467862ae21d5c0ea5ce1b45b89db7807ee3a5f927f232b:12

value
638164300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23eed5e8bf4a5480d98855e2069e8a0bbd2260e9 OP_EQUALVERIFY OP_CHECKSIG
address
14GzmJUUvMLGpVgxfRS9FjZzj3SwMWUwrF
transaction
52b8ec58cf4d49395f467862ae21d5c0ea5ce1b45b89db7807ee3a5f927f232b
spent
true